summ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orQt Continuous Integration System <qt-info@nokia.com>2010-06-03 02:05:09 +0200
committerQt Continuous Integration System <qt-info@nokia.com>2010-06-03 02:05:09 +0200
commitf26fbd5d93d904ffe46f82070b4114d9f27a9427 (patch)
tree5598e0128500ed5091916c222c3bd330de3dac55
parent932b4b95cf4c7cc250b2c3f23d9b903292f84ab4 (diff)
parent33213ad69d29dbe82395bf3865e4f80128edd6a6 (diff)
Merge branch '4.6' of scm.dev.nokia.troll.no:qt/oslo-staging-1 into 4.6-integration
* '4.6' of scm.dev.nokia.troll.no:qt/oslo-staging-1: qmake: don't warn about unknown MSVC compiler option /MP
-rw-r--r--qmake/generators/win32/msvc_objectmodel.cpp6
1 files changed, 6 insertions, 0 deletions
diff --git a/qmake/generators/win32/msvc_objectmodel.cpp b/qmake/generators/win32/msvc_objectmodel.cpp
index 5f3d433f60..ee7b228f35 100644
--- a/qmake/generators/win32/msvc_objectmodel.cpp
+++ b/qmake/generators/win32/msvc_objectmodel.cpp
@@ -673,6 +673,12 @@ bool VCCLCompilerTool::parseOption(const char* option)
if(third == 'd')
RuntimeLibrary = rtMultiThreadedDebug;
break;
+ } else if (second == 'P') {
+ if (config->CompilerVersion >= NET2005)
+ AdditionalOptions += option;
+ else
+ warn_msg(WarnLogic, "/MP option is not supported in Visual C++ < 2005, ignoring.");
+ break;
}
found = false; break;
case 'O':